Let me explain the steps to enable offline access for your google document and spreadsheets.

Before going to this process if you haven’t install google gear install it.

Step 1)

Click on the link ‘offline’ on the top right of your google docs. You will get a pop up like below. Click on the check box and mark google doc as a trusted site.

Step 2)

Click on the enable offline access button. After clicking the button you will get another pop up

Step 3)

Create desktop shortcut for google doc. After allowing this it will start synchronization, that is a sluggish process. Don’t worry it will complete in some minutes.

After some time you will get a tick mark on the top right, that means your google doc is downloaded to your local machine. Disconnect your internet connection and go some place where you don’t have a internet access. Click on the google docs icon on your desktop.

Some basic tips.

The offline access is system dependent. If you need to access from different system you need to repeat the same process in all the system.
The offline access is browser dependent. You can’t share it with IE, mozilla, since data are saved in different folder.
The offline access is operating system dependent. You can’t share between operating system.
